What exchange takes place between lord and vassal in a feudal contract ?

History
1 answer:
Zepler [3.9K]3 years ago
8 0
The lord would provide to the vassal land from which they could make money from and in return the vassal would contribute troops to the lords army. Sometimes vassals would also pay a small fee of grain or various other goods as a sort of tax for the land.

Civil liberties and rights of United States
Solnce55 [7]

Civil liberties are protections against government actions. For example, the First Amendment of the Bill of Rights guarantees citizens the right to practice whatever religion they please. Government, then, cannot interfere in an individual's freedom of worship.
